- 2
- 0
- 约3.24千字
- 约 8页
- 2026-05-20 发布于河北
- 举报
数据库完整性习题解答
一、选择题(每题3分,共30分)
1.以下关于数据库完整性的说法,错误的是()
A.实体完整性确保表中每行数据的唯一性
B.参照完整性主要用于维护表之间数据的一致性
C.用户定义完整性由数据库管理员自行定义
D.数据完整性只关注数据的准确性,不关心数据的一致性
2.在关系数据库中,实现实体完整性的是()
A.外键约束
B.主键约束
C.检查约束
D.默认约束
3.若有两个表,一个是学生表(包含学号、姓名等字段),另一个是成绩表(包含学号、课程号、成绩等字段),要确保成绩表中的学号与学生表中的学号一致,应建立()
A.实体完整性约束
B.参照完整性约束
C.用户定义完整性约束
D.以上都不对
4.以下哪种约束可以限制某个字段的值必须在一定范围内()
A.主键约束
B.外键约束
C.检查约束
D.默认约束
5.当删除主表中的记录时,为了保证参照表中的数据一致性,应设置()
A.级联删除
B.级联更新
C.限制删除
D.无操作
6.数据库完整性机制的作用不包括()
A.防止非法用户访问数据库
B.保证数据的正确性
C.维护数据的一致性
D.提高数据的安全性
7.对于一个具有自增属性的字段,应使用()来保证其完整性。
A.主键约束
B.唯一约束
C.默认约束
D.以上
原创力文档

文档评论(0)